Output a75620bbf1a3c26bb21d54e792b70131a2d12d40d5efeabe2906443120939feb:0

value
7528481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ced6040897305c8779d42cd36b5de791486811c OP_EQUAL
address
32sNQ21mA5USGdndAur4HeNFVhsj9ubHpb
transaction
a75620bbf1a3c26bb21d54e792b70131a2d12d40d5efeabe2906443120939feb
confirmations
229661
spent
true